Belton Business Park gets a new entrance as city-wide growth continues

BELTON, Texas (KWTX) – Avenue D will be extended to create a new entrance to the Belton Business Park, reducing traffic. Construction will coincide with a TxDOT project to widen Loop 121.

A $2.4 million bid from Gate & Cade Construction to widen Avenue D was approved by the Belton City Council in July 2024. The Belton Economic Corporation will fund the project with revenue from a sales tax.

The project includes infrastructure improvements for further developments that may take place in the park.

A traffic impact analysis of Belton Business Park found that the area is a high traffic volume area.

Belton Economic Corporation Executive Director Cynthia Hernandez said TxDOT's project to widen Loop 121 and add a traffic light motivated the BEC board to approve the Avenue D extension.

“The timing of this project is important because we wanted the road to be completed when TXDOT completed the Loop 121 project,” Hernandez said.

The project envisages an extension of Avenue D to the intersection with Kennedy Court.

Hernandez said the traffic reduction from the new entrance would benefit businesses and residents around Belton Business Park.

“It's about just getting from point A to point B. It's about just getting to work or to your destination within the business park,” Hernandez said.

Construction began in August 2024 and the project is scheduled for completion in early 2025.
